121 schoenebeck 2512 /** Audio Device Parameter 'SAMPLERATE'
122     *
123     * Used to retrieve the sample rate of the JACK audio output
124     * device. Even though the sample rate of the JACK server might
125     * change during runtime, the JACK API currently however does not
126     * allow clients to change the sample rate. So this parameter is
127     * read only.
128     *
129     * This base parameter class has just been overridden for this JACK
130     * driver to implement a valid default value for sample rate. The
131     * default value will simply return the sample rate of the currently
132     * running JACK server. It will return "nothing" if the JACK server
133     * is not running at that point.
134     */
135 schoenebeck 2513 class ParameterSampleRate : public AudioOutputDevice::ParameterSampleRate {
136 schoenebeck 2512 public:
137     ParameterSampleRate();
138     ParameterSampleRate(String s);
139     virtual optional<int> DefaultAsInt(std::map<String,String> Parameters) OVERRIDE;
140     virtual void OnSetValue(int i) throw (Exception) OVERRIDE;
141     };

174     /** JACK client
175     *
176     * Represents a jack client. This class is shared by
177     * AudioOutputDeviceJack and MidiInputDeviceJack. The jack server
178     * calls JackClient::Process, which in turn calls
179     * AudioOutputDeviceJack::Process and/or
180     * MidiInputDeviceJack::Process.
181     */
182     class JackClient {

225     /**
226     * Currently not derived / instantiated by the sampler itself, however this
227     * class can be subclassed and used i.e. by a GUI build on top of the sampler,
228     * to react on JACK events. Because registering JACK callback functions through
229     * the general JACK API is not possible after the JACK client has been activated,
230     * and the latter is already the case as soon as an AudioOutputDeviceJack object
231     * has been instantiated.
232     */
233     class JackListener {
234     public:
235 schoenebeck 2444 virtual void onJackShutdown(jack_status_t code, const char* reason) = 0;
236 schoenebeck 2412 };
